Great packged radio for a AM/SSB mobile, RX is pretty good even through the little front speaker, clear and with certain "tone" settings , comfortable to listen to. Now for the TX, Its stable (no drifting on ssb mode) but the power out put on this unit is very little. Out of the box its out put was 3 watts on AM with around a .5watt fwd swing. Its clear but not very loud audio. The SSB power out put, was the same, peak power was 3.5 watts. Most of the AM/SSB radios I have used would do around 12watts on ssb and around the same on AM 3 to 4 watts. There is only 2 adjustments that can be made by a person for the 12 watt out put on SSB. If your not familiar with tuning and setting power out put, best leave that to a radio tech. I did manage to adjust mine to do 12 to 14 watts peak on SSB and on AM I left the carrier at 3 watts and was able to achive a decent 7-8 watts by voice (peak power) All in All a fairly simple radio to run even while mobile once the menu settings are to your liking.. Recomend it out of the box? no, but after a adjustment is made its not a bad value. The Board looks fairly solid (inside) so if its in a rough riding truck / jeep/4x4 Id say it would take a beating. SWR meter is amazing in this radio. It beeps faster and faster the closer you get to 1.0 so you don't have to go in and out of the vehicle to constantly check it. Auto Squelch works perfectly. USB and LSB with the clarifier tuners works very well. The display color options are amazing but green and orange looks the best at day and night from any angle. Blue is not that great. Noise blocker and high frequency cut off for high pitch static both works very well. Roger beep can be turned on or off. Mic is very nice with channel up and down controls. I paired my radio with 18ft of RG8X cable and a Firestick FS11 antenna and I get 1.0 SWR from about channel 10 to 30 and the other channels are at 1.2 so it is a very well tuned setup and transmits and receives very well. I talked to a friend that was on a home base station over 10 miles away with forest between us on a regular AM channel not using side band. The weather radio works great. You can also get full schematics from the President company and fully service and mod this radio on your own. It's over built like a tank but has a small compact size. Full metal body. Front facing speaker is awesome and gets very loud. Easy to hear over a loud 6.5L V8 diesel engine. Compact size fits in most locations in car or truck. Controls set thru menu like new am-fm radios. When paired with a good antenna rx and tx are acceptable for cb band. Weather band is useful for on road alert conditions. Don't recommend any President brand antennas use Wilson or Firestik antennas for more adjustability for lower tuned SWR readings with this radio. Front firing speaker has enough volume in dash except for the most loud truck cabs. Built in swr calibration is ok for spot check just not as accurate as outboard unit Dosy tr1000 meter.
